Searching for a Destination in the Address Book

Use this function to search for a destination registered in the destination list or on the LDAP server.
• To search for a destination from an LDAP server, the LDAP server must be registered in advance, under
Prog/Chnge/Del LDAP Server, in System Settings. For details about registering LDAP servers, see
"System Settings", Network and System Settings Guide.
• The search returns destinations whose first characters match the entered characters.
• A warning message appears if the search returns more than the maximum number of destinations you
can search for at a time. Press [Exit] and change the destination name to view fewer destinations.
• For the maximum number of destinations you can search at a time, see "Maximum Values".

Search by Name

This section explains how to search for a destination registered in the Address Book by name.
• If [LDAP Search] is set to [Off] in Administrator Tools, in the System Settings menu, the display for
selecting either [Search Address Book] or [Search LDAP] does not appear.
1.
Press the [Search Destination] key.
